小编Kor*_*los的帖子

我是否必须切换到 https 才能在 Chrome 92 中使用“SharedArrayBuffer”?

我的网站不适用于 Chrome 92。使用 Chrome 91 一切都很好。问题是SharedArrayBuffer自 Chrome 92 以来就没有启用。当我尝试通过添加标题“Cross-Origin-Embedder-Policy:requre-corp 和 Cross-Origin-Opener-Policy:same-origin”来启用它时,我收到错误信息:

\n
\n

Cross-Origin-Opener-Policy 标头已被忽略,因为来源不可信。它是在最终响应或重定向中定义的。请使用 HTTPS 协议传递响应。您还可以使用“localhost”原点。请参阅https://www.w3.org/TR/powerful-features/#potentially-trustworthy-originhttps://html.spec.whatwg.org/#the-cross-origin-opener-policy-header

\n
\n

“请使用 HTTPS 协议传递响应”是否意味着我必须切换到 HTTPS 才能使用SharedArrayBuffer?如果是这样,原因是什么?

\n

javascript https http

3
推荐指数
1
解决办法
1万
查看次数

标签 统计

http ×1

https ×1

javascript ×1